Indefinity Box (2011/2020)
Helium Filled Balloons, Blown Glass, Water, Sheet Glass, Monofiliment
1800 FT H x 18” W x 18”D
Two helium filled balloons rise to roughly 600 meters into the sky at which point they create a temporary object at ground level. 600 meters is the height that the first atomic bomb was detonated at over the city of Hiroshima, Japan on August 6, 1945. This piece has been performed in Toyama, Japan, Seattle, WA, and Ridgefield, CT.
